Could any one find Mary Naylor/Baines on the 1861 census. She was born in Bradford, possibly Wyke, in around 1852.
In the 71 census she was living with the White family in north Bierley as Mary Naylor and married Joseph White in 1872 in the name of Mary Naylor Baines.

this looks like her. On her marriage she says her father is Edward Baines. In 1871 there is a Matilom/Mahlom Naylor with her who on his marriage says his father is Edward Naylor.

1861  3310/ 23/ 9

Beck Hill North Bierley Yorkshire

Edward Baines 37 yrs
Ann Baines 33 yrs
Richard Baines 14 yrs
Thomas Baines 12 yrs
Emma Baines 11 yrs
Mary Baines 9 yrs
James Baines 6 yrs
Ephraim Baines 4 yrs
Malern Baines 2 yrs
John Baines 61 yrs

In 1851  2304/ 13/19

Edward and Ann and some children are with his parents John and Mary Baines. Mary is older than John.
I think that the Naylor connection may be that John Baines married Mary Naylor in 1833, so Edward was probably a Naylor by birth.
